Understanding Reverse Mortgages While Becoming Homeowners
A reverse mortgage allows homeowners aged 62 and older to convert their home’s equity into cash without selling the property. Unlike traditional mortgages where you make monthly payments to build equity, reverse mortgages work in the opposite direction – the lender pays you based on your home’s value.
In home buying, a reverse mortgage for purchase presents a great opportunity. Instead of having to wait years to build up equity the traditional way through mortgage payments, you can instantly gain the required equity during the purchase process. This strategy accesses the equity as soon as the homeownership starts.
You might be wondering: can you purchase a home with a reverse mortgage? The answer is yes. Advantages of Utilizing Reverse Mortgages to Buy Residences
Stop Monthly Mortgage Payments
The best advantage that comes with purchasing with a reverse mortgage is the freedom from monthly mortgage repayments. Upon completing the purchase, you will never again be forced to send any monthly repayments to the lender. This is a big plus to your monthly cash flow, where the money is channeled elsewhere, used to pay your healthcare, or otherwise live your best retirement without the offsetting mortgage repayments.
Improved Financial Flexibility
Without monthly mortgage payments, your dependable income goes further. This additional financial flexibility is of special importance during retirement, where other income sources are sometimes meager. You’re free to devote your resources to medical care, vacations, assistance to relatives, or whatever your objectives are, without the expense of mortgage payments.
Maintain Other Properties
To buy a home with a reverse mortgage, you get to keep other retirement funds. Instead of tapping all your investments, retirement accounts, or savings to pay cash to purchase the home, you’ll keep some intact for other purposes while still reaching homeownership. This option prevents the compromise of your long-term financial security.
Important Considerations
While reverse mortgages offer compelling benefits for home purchases, they require careful consideration. You must still maintain the property, pay property taxes, and keep homeowners insurance current. The loan balance will increase over time as interest accrues, which affects the equity available to you or your heirs later. It’s also essential to factor in the reverse mortgage costs in South Carolina, which may vary depending on location and lender.
Moreover, a reverse mortgage for a home purchase also includes some eligibility requirements, including age restrictions, credit checks, and more. The house must also be up to certain standards as well as be your primary residence.
